Readiness for STEM Education in Kansas
The state of Kansas faces significant barriers in providing comprehensive STEM education to its youth, particularly in its rural areas. According to the Kansas Department of Education, many rural districts struggle with insufficient funding and resources for effective STEM programs. The rural-urban divide in Kansas means that while urban centers like Kansas City and Wichita might have advanced technological facilities and STEM-oriented programs, many rural schools continue to lack access to essential tools and interactive learning opportunities. This disparity has led to a decline in student engagement and interest in STEM fields, which are critical for the future workforce.
In Kansas, students in rural communities often face unique challenges that exacerbate the educational gap. Teachers in these areas may not have the requisite training or resources to effectively deliver STEM education. Furthermore, many students do not have access to extracurricular STEM-related initiatives, such as robotics clubs or coding camps. The challenge is not just a lack of funding but also the absence of infrastructure, such as reliable internet access and modern classroom technologies, which are crucial for fostering skills in science, technology, engineering, and mathematics. As a result, Kansas educators are searching for innovative funding opportunities that can address these systemic issues.
The funding initiative for STEM camps explicitly emphasizes supporting project-based learning that engages local educators and their students. With the grant, teachers can propose innovative programs that encourage hands-on activities and problem-solving skills. For example, funding could support STEM camps in rural Kansas that focus on robotics, coding, or environmental science, all of which are critical for developing a skilled workforce. By emphasizing local contexts and delivering relevant educational experiences, the program seeks to build students' competencies while rekindling their interest in STEM disciplines.
Moreover, this funding addresses the teacher capacity gap by allowing educators to create tailored projects that reflect the needs of their students. With a commitment to project-based learning, teachers can design initiatives that do not simply present the curriculum but also integrate real-world applications. By focusing on local issues or industries, such as agriculture tech or renewable energy, grants can help educators create engaging experiences that prepare students for future careers in Kansas. Overall, this funding initiative stands to significantly enhance the readiness of Kansas youth for STEM careers, bridging the gaps brought about by geographical and socioeconomic disparities.
Engaging local community members and industries is also a vital component of the funding strategy. Educators are encouraged to collaborate with local businesses and experts to provide mentorship opportunities and real-world insights into STEM fields. This collaboration not only enriches the learning experience but facilitates the development of a pipeline for future employment opportunities within Kansas. Providing students with exposure to local industries fosters a deeper understanding of the skills required and encourages them to pursue careers in those fields, ultimately contributing to the local economy.
In conclusion, the successful implementation of this funding initiative in Kansas holds the potential to transform the educational landscape in rural communities. Fostering STEM learning through innovative project-based strategies not only addresses immediate barriers but also positions Kansas students for future success in an increasingly technological world. By equipping educators with the necessary resources to leverage local contexts, the initiative will pave the way for a more equitable educational environment and contribute to the state’s economic vitality.
